Exam details;

Exam Title: Palo Alto Networks Certified Network Security Engineer
Exam Code: PCNSE
Number of Questions: 75 Questions
Duration: 80 min.
Availability: Pearson VUE Testing Center
Test Format: Multiple choice
Passing score: 70%  ( they didn't announce it anymore but it used to be 70% )
Language Exam: English

Palo Alto PCNSE Exam Topics:

=========================


Plan [  16% ]

- Identify how the Palo Alto Networks products work together to detect and prevent threats
- Given a scenario, identify how to design an implementation of the firewall to meet business requirements that leverage the Palo Alto Networks product portfolio
- Given a scenario, identify how to design an implementation of firewalls in High Availability to meet business requirements that leverage the Palo     Alto Networks product portfolio
- Identify the appropriate interface type and configuration for a specified network deployment
- Identify strategies for retaining logs using Distributed Log Collection
- Given a scenario, identify the strategy that should be implemented for Distributed Log Collection
- Identify how to use template stacks for administering Palo Alto Networks firewalls as a scalable solution using Panorama
- Identify how to use device group hierarchy for administering Palo Alto Networks firewalls as a scalable solution using Panorama
- Identify planning considerations unique to deploying Palo Alto Networks firewalls in a public cloud
- Identify planning considerations unique to deploying Palo Alto Networks firewalls in a hybrid cloud
- Identify planning considerations unique to deploying Palo Alto Networks firewalls in a private cloud
- Identify methods for authorization, authentication, and device administration
- Identify the methods of certificate creation on the firewall
- Identify options available in the firewall to support dynamic routing
- Given a scenario, identify ways to mitigate resource exhaustion (because of denial-of-service) in application servers
- Identify decryption deployment strategies
- Identify the impact of application override to the overall functionality of the firewall
- Identify the methods of User-ID redistribution
- Identify VM-Series bootstrap components and their function


# Deploy and Configure [  23% ]

- Identify the application meanings in the Traffic log (incomplete, insufficient data, non-syn TCP, not applicable, unknown TCP, unknown UDP, and unknown P2P)- Given a scenario, identify the set of Security Profiles that should be used
- Identify the relationship between URL filtering and credential theft prevention
- Implement and maintain the App-ID adoption
- Identify how to create security rules to implement App-ID without relying on port-based rules
- Identify configurations for distributed Log Collectors
- Identify the required settings and steps necessary to provision and deploy a next-generation firewall
- Identify which device of an HA pair is the active partner
- Identify various methods for authentication, authorization, and device administration within PAN-OS software for connecting to the firewall
- Identify how to configure and maintain certificates to support firewall features
- Identify the features that support IPv6
- Identify how to configure a virtual router
- Given a scenario, identify how to configure an interface as a DHCP relay agent
- Identify the configuration settings for site-to-site VPN
- Identify the configuration settings for GlobalProtect
- Identify how to configure features of NAT policy rules
- Given a configuration example including DNAT, identify how to configure security rules
- Identify how to configure decryption
- Given a scenario, identify an application override configuration and use case
- Identify how to configure VM-Series firewalls for deployment
- Identify how to configure firewalls to use tags and filtered log forwarding for integration with network automation


# Operate [  20% ]

- Identify considerations for configuring external log forwarding
- Interpret log files, reports, and graphs to determine traffic and threat trends
- Identify scenarios in which there is a benefit from using custom signatures
- Given a scenario, identify the process to update a Palo Alto Networks system to the latest version of the software
- Identify how configuration management operations are used to ensure desired operational state of stability and continuity
- Identify the settings related to critical HA functions (link monitoring; path monitoring; HA1, HA2, HA3, and HA4 functionality; HA backup links; and differences between A/A and A/P HA pairs and HA clusters)
- Identify the sources of information that pertain to HA functionality
- Identify how to configure the firewall to integrate with AutoFocus and verify its functionality
- Identify the impact of deploying dynamic updates
- Identify the relationship between Panorama and devices as pertaining to dynamic updates versions and policy implementation and/or HA peers


# Configuration Troubleshooting [  18% ]

- Identify system and traffic issues using the web interface and CLI tools
- Given a session output, identify the configuration requirements used to perform a packet capture
- Given a scenario, identify how to troubleshoot and configure interface components
- Identify how to troubleshoot SSL decryption failures
- Identify issues with the certificate chain of trust
- Given a scenario, identify how to troubleshoot traffic routing issues


# Core Concepts [  23% ]

- Identify the correct order of the policy evaluation based on the packet flow architecture
- Given an attack scenario against firewall resources, identify the appropriate Palo Alto Networks threat prevention component to prevent or mitigate the attack
- Given an attack scenario against resources behind the firewall, identify the appropriate Palo Alto Networks threat prevention component to prevent or mitigate the attack
- Identify methods for identifying users
- Identify the fundamental functions residing on the management plane and data plane of a Palo Alto Networks firewall
- Given a scenario, determine how to control bandwidth use on a per-application basis
- Identify the fundamental functions and concepts of WildFire
- Identify the purpose of and use case for MFA and the Authentication policy
- Identify the dependencies for implementing MFA
- Given a scenario, identify how to forward traffic
- Given a scenario, identify how to configure policies and related objects
- Identify the methods for automating the configuration of a firewall
